Fix phpdoc for serializer normalizers exceptions

The normalizers throw exceptions. They need to be documented for DX
in the normalizer/denormalizer interfaces.

[Serializer] fit Symfony phpdoc standard

It also adds meaning of each exception throw.

Fix grammary in phpdoc

/**
* Defines the interface of denormalizers.
*
@ -27,6 +34,13 @@ interface DenormalizerInterface
* @param array $context options available to the denormalizer
*
* @return object
*
* @throws BadMethodCallException Occurs when the normalizer is not called in an expected context
* @throws InvalidArgumentException Occurs when the arguments are not coherent or not supported
* @throws UnexpectedValueException Occurs when the item cannot be hydrated with the given data
* @throws ExtraAttributesException Occurs when the item doesn't have attribute to receive given data
* @throws LogicException Occurs when the normalizer is not supposed to denormalize
* @throws RuntimeException Occurs if the class cannot be instantiated
*/
public function denormalize($data, $class, $format = null, array $context = array());

/**
* Defines the interface of normalizers.
*
@ -26,6 +30,11 @@ interface NormalizerInterface
* @param array $context Context options for the normalizer
*
* @return array|scalar
*
* @throws InvalidArgumentException Occurs when the object given is not an attempted type for the normalizer
* @throws CircularReferenceException Occurs when the normalizer detects a circular reference when no circular
* reference handler can fix it
* @throws LogicException Occurs when the normalizer is not called in an expected context
*/
public function normalize($object, $format = null, array $context = array());
